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0905387965 270 86352 3159
9398 39600773899 8713337487
9398 39600773899 8713337487
320710826 44727 932842 551343 980
All about undefined
Interested in learning more?
9398 39600773899 8713337487
320710826 44727 932842 551343 980
See more
63 7481856 2923
0231382 91 170371633
See more
5913653 272525
1342616585 654741 676
See more